Executive Product Owner - Banker Workbench
See Yourself in our Team
You’ll join Customer Channels and Data within Business Bank, working in the CRM Workbench Crew. The Crew is building an AI-enabled platform that is reshaping relationship management into a hybrid-agentic model, giving frontline teams greater capacity to focus on the interactions that matter most. It is a significant opportunity to shape the core customer context and intelligence layer that sits at the heart of Banker Workbench.
Do Work that Matters
As Executive Product Owner for CRM Core, you will define and lead the product strategy for the foundational customer capabilities that make Banker Workbench intelligent, trusted and commercially effective. This includes Customer 360, relationships and hierarchies, segmentation, customer-to-portfolio assignment, and the containment and exposure of strategic customer signals.
You will work at the intersection of customer experience, data, analytics, AI and platform transformation to build a reusable, AI-ready layer of customer truth. This is a role for someone who can connect strategic intent with data-rich product thinking, strengthen the bank’s proprietary CRM data moat, and enable sharper sales and service outcomes through high-quality, explainable customer context and signals.
